Historic Colorado River ferry and supply settlement at the mouth of White Canyon, later inundated as Lake Powell rose. Cass Hite’s river landing and the mid-century Hite Marina era mark a major Glen Canyon travel node. The modern Hite Crossing / residual marina approaches keep the name on the map; the pin is the historical ferry–town place, not a swimming beach.
